    Peggy Walton-Walker

    American film and television actress (born 1943)

    Peggy Walton-Walker is an American film and television actress.

    Early years

    She was born Peggy Jean Walton in 1943[1] in Charleston, South Carolina.[2] Walton-Walker attended Vigor High School in Prichard, Alabama, where she graduated in 1961.[citation needed] She went on to earn a Bachelor of Music degree from Birmingham-Southern College in 1965, the same year in which she was selected and crowned as Miss Birmingham-Southern College.[2]

    Career

    Most of Walton-Walker's film and television roles have been small, often playing an unnamed character such as a bookkeeper, receptionist, or nurse.

    However, she had a featured role on A Different World in the 1990 episode "Pride and Prejudice" as Amy, a retail sales clerk dismissive of a black customer, who then makes excessive purchases in a failed effort to counteract the prejudice, later returning the purchases
